My wife and I discovered an easy, if not painless, way to save the Dwarf.

The hint is when the Spirit of the Priest says that he "Knows that the Demon can be killed by torturing the Dwarf long enough. The Dwarf could take it, but the Priest could not."

The Dwarf says the same in that he can take it but that the DEMON cannot. The Demon keeps telling you to stop if you hit the Dwarf. The Demon also "hates his bloody prison" after you wound the Dwarf enough.

It's like a riddle... and the solution is:

To beat on the Dwarf and bring him to 1 health using the spell "Living on the Edge", then healing him back to full health. Repeat this 6 times. After 6 rounds of doing this, you will notice your characters gain experience, signifying that the demon has died. Kill the final tower, free the Dwarf, and the Demon pops out of him [i]completely dead[/i]!

After reading this thread I have spent whole evening to save the dwarf.
My solution:
Damge him and heal over and over again. (No need for Living On The Edge - I dont use it, and had no money to try it, neither % loss will not trigger demon)
There will be dialog which will inform you about deamon coming out. (You will learn after few fails)
Best would be he stays down the pit. Keep him knocked down or stunned otherwise he will escape (Nether swap) and you will have to teleport him down.
When the time comes dwarf needs to have some HP so fight him longer to reset cooldown on heals.
Now key to victory is to run away from room. Job must be done by your minions.
In my case each team member can summon Bone Widow but most job did Incarnate with Power,Shadow and Warp Infusions.
So demon poped out and met my puppets.

I don't understand fully mechanic. Sometimes I was able to damage demon with my heroes and sometimes I was possessd right away after damaging it. Maybe he got some range of this possesion ? I have save I will try it.

Maybe I was doing something wrong, but I cycled through the Possessed Dwarf more than a dozen times -- taking him down to 1HP with resist death and healing him back up before starting again -- and I never got the quest credit prior to breaking the last pillar. When I did finally break it, the demon emerged at full HP. Since he kept possessing my guys through normal combat, I reloaded it and had my summoner spawn a buffed up incarnate in the pit, moved everyone else back to the entrance to avoid becoming possessed, and then let my Incarnate break the last pillar and face-tank the demon down with the help of the now-exorcised dwarf. It wasn't too hard and the dwarf seemed immune to repossession, so after a few rounds the demon was dead and we got the quest XP.

The other method(s) listed here might work -- or have worked in prior builds? -- but knocking down or chain-stunning the demon still resulted in one of my characters being possessed, and it was getting super tedious having to then drive it out of one of my characters and start over again. Thankfully going the summoner route really made this easy, so I'm assuming there's a ranged component to the demonic possession "ability" that you'll otherwise get trolled with if you hang around and duke it out conventionally.

YMMV, but does anyone know if either A) I was doing something wrong with the initial strategy, or B) if that doesn't actually work like that anymore?
